The Centre for Advanced Language Learning of Eötvös Loránd University (ELTE) is a non-profit institution. The main focus of the more than thirty-year-old institution is the administration of examinations, but it is involved in language teaching, as well. There are more than 130,000 candidates each year and examinations are administered in 27 languages, Hungarian as a foreign language among them. The Budapest-based institution has a nationwide network with locations for administering examinations in the largest universities of the country and in other educational institutions as well. A central staff of about 50 control and coordinate the work of more than 1100 examiners. One of the important tasks of the institution is the standardised assessment of knowledge of the Hungarian language and culture within the framework of a modern system of examinations.
